This project demonstrates a simple implementation of dependency injection in PHP using a custom Dependency Injection Container (DiContainer
). The examples include binding classes to callback solutions, creating class instances, and resolving methods with resolvable dependencies.
- PHP environment
- Composer installed
composer require lcmialichi/dicontainer
<?php
namespace Tests;
class UnresolvableParams
{
private $param1;
private $param2;
public function __construct($param1, $param2)
{
$this->param1 = $param1;
$this->param2 = $param2;
}
// Additional methods or functionality can be added here
}
<?php
namespace Tests;
class ResolvableParams
{
public function __construct(private UnresolvableParams $unresolvableParams)
{
}
public function executeTest(DateTime $time, stdClass $stdClass): bool
{
return true;
}
}
<?php
require_once __DIR__ . "/vendor/autoload.php";
use DiContainer\Container;
use Tests\ResolvableParams;
use Tests\UnresolvableParams;
// Create a container instance.
$container = new Container;
// Bind a class to a callback solution.
$container->bind(UnresolvableParams::class, function ($container) {
return new UnresolvableParams("first parameter", "second parameter");
});
// Create an instance of UnresolvedParams from the container.
$resolved = $container->make(UnresolvableParams::class);
// Since we have already bound UnresolvableParams in the container,
// it will automatically resolve the class.
$resolved = $container->make(ResolvableParams::class);
// Resolving a method from a class, in case the dependencies are resolvable.
$resolvedMethod = $container->callable(ResolvableParams::class . "@executeTest");
var_dump($resolvedMethod) // outputs true;
